Output d61aaf2f99bdccc33e0b1a8cff77d6c1c4f0758f9da9c6aa83fbdc8419d54c31:2

value
110000
script pubkey
OP_0 OP_PUSHBYTES_20 c3d463ca21471a817d19c2bd5e71a9e9035935d8
address
tb1qc02x8j3pgudgzlgec274uudfayp4jdwc8c8zjw
transaction
d61aaf2f99bdccc33e0b1a8cff77d6c1c4f0758f9da9c6aa83fbdc8419d54c31
confirmations
25133
spent
true